Are people in Fletcher older or younger than people in Oak Creek?
- The Median Age in Fletcher is 0.9 years younger than in Oak Creek.

Are housing costs cheaper in Fletcher or Oak Creek?
- Fletcher housing costs are 31.0% less expensive than Oak Creek hous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Fletcher or Oak Creek?
- The average commute for residents of Fletcher is 0.8 minutes longer than it is for residents of Oak Creek.
